Hi Nathan -

What this looks like is that when you added server C to the CellServDB's,
the ptserver instances on all 3 machines were not restarted.

My suggestion is to restart the ptserver process on all 3 database
machines.

This is what I get on C after adding C to CellServDB and starting ptserver
on it with no prdb* files in /usr/afs/db.

------------------------
troot-srvtst04(136)> udebug srvtst04 7002 -long
Host's addresses are: 131.151.1.229
Host's 131.151.1.229 time is Fri Mar 16 09:55:35 2001
Local time is Fri Mar 16 09:55:36 2001 (time differential 1 secs)
Last yes vote not cast yet
Local db version is 1.1
I am not sync site
Lowest host 131.151.1.229 was set 0 secs ago
Sync host 0.0.0.0 was set 984758135 secs ago
Sync site's db version is 0.0
0 locked pages, 0 of them for write

Server (131.151.1.228): (db 0.0)
    last vote rcvd 0 secs ago (at Fri Mar 16 09:55:36 2001),
    last beacon sent 0 secs ago (at Fri Mar 16 09:55:36 2001), last vote
was
no
    dbcurrent=0, up=1 beaconSince=1

Server (131.151.1.227): (db 0.0)
    last vote rcvd 0 secs ago (at Fri Mar 16 09:55:36 2001),
    last beacon sent 0 secs ago (at Fri Mar 16 09:55:36 2001), last vote
was
no
    dbcurrent=0, up=1 beaconSince=1
---------------------------

One thing that is very interesting is that on all three servers - the
"lowest host was set" has the wrong IP. It has the local host's ip, which
is
a little odd.

> > For the life of me, I can't figure out what is going on...
> I have three
> > servers with sequential IP addresses (x.x.x.227, 228, 229).
> I can get the DB
> > server running fine on the first server by itself. I can
> add the second
> > server, let it run for a bit, and it happily syncs up and
> sets 227 as the
> > sync site. However, no matter what I try, I can't get the
> third server to
> > join in.
> >
> > I followed this:
> > A+B in all /usr/afs/etc/CellServDB
> > A+B running ptserver happily, sync site is A
> > Add C to all /usr/afs/etc/CellServDB
> > Run ptserver C (either with an existing copy of prdb* or nothing in
> > /usr/afs/db/)
> > Wait.
> >
> > It never sees a syncsite. If I then go and restart ptserver
> on A, NONE of
> > the servers will ever elect a syncsite.
> >
> > Connectivity between the servers appears fine (they should
> all be on the
> > same switch I think). Everything else on the servers is
> happy, including
> > running the VLDB on all three servers.
> >
> > Is there something obvious I am missing or not doing?
